What REVOLVE GROUP CLASS A INC does

Revolve Group operates an online fashion marketplace that curates and sells designer, contemporary and emerging brand apparel, footwear and accessories. The platform leverages a community of engaged customers and influencers to drive brand discovery and sales. Revolve also operates FWRD, a luxury fashion marketplace, and has expanded into men's fashion. The company sources products from third-party brands as well as develops its own proprietary branded merchandise.

What changed in the latest 10-Q

AI-assisted comparison of RVLV's 10-Q filed 2026-05-05 against the prior one filed 2025-11-04.

Management's Discussion & Analysis (MD&A)

  • Added:
    • Bullet point added in risk factors (filed 2026-05-05): 'geopolitical tensions, wars, and their impact on global economic conditions, supply chains and consumer demand'
  • Removed:
    • Reference to 'home products' removed from Overview description (filed 2026-05-05)
  • Reworded:
    • Product count changed from 'over 110,000 apparel and footwear styles' to 'over 140,000 apparel and footwear styles' (filed 2026-05-05)
    • Brand count changed from 'over 1,400 emerging, established and owned brands as of December 31, 2024' to 'over 1,600 emerging, established and owned brands' with date reference removed (filed 2026-05-05)
    • Phrase 'continued investment' changed to 'investment' in Overview section (filed 2026-05-05)
    • Phrase 'redefining fashion retail for the 21st century' shortened to 'redefining fashion retail' (filed 2026-05-05)
    • Reference to 'home products' removed from REVOLVE segment description (filed 2026-05-05)
    • Date reference 'as of December 31, 2024' removed from both product offering and brand count statements (filed 2026-05-05)
